Is Oxford OX25 6 a good place to live?
In Oxford (OX25 6), recorded crime is 87% below the national average, homes sell for around £878,200 on average, flood risk from rivers and the sea is high, and it ranks as one of the less deprived parts of the country (deprivation decile 8/10, where 1 is most deprived).

Flood risk in Oxford OX25 6
Flood risk from rivers and the sea in Oxford OX25 6 is rated high. Around 0.4% of properties (3 of 721) sit in a modelled flood zone, of which 2 are at significant risk.
Source: Environment Agency, Risk of Flooding from Rivers and Sea, updated 2026-06-27. Surface-water and groundwater flooding are modelled separately and are not included here. Commission an official flood search before purchase.
